#44017f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44017f is composed of 26.7% red, 0.4%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.5%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 271.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 25.1%. #44017f color hex could be obtained by blending #8802fe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#44017f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44017f has RGB values of R:68, G:1,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4456831.

Shades and Tints of #44017f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05000a is the darkest color, while #fbf6ff is the lightest one.
